Perfect Square
6648000375561873446806058441635078020582586681 is a perfect square (81535270745621943061291 × 81535270745621943061291)
6648000375561873446806058441635078020582586681 is a perfect square (81535270745621943061291 × 81535270745621943061291)
6648000375561873446806058441635078020582586681 is odd
Previous odd number is 6648000375561873446806058441635078020582586679
Next odd number is 6648000375561873446806058441635078020582586683
100101010000110110100110100110110110111110011100001011110111110100101110011010001110010100110010110001011101011011101101101101110111111111011100100111001
293814419586892327781421341715786722271049960007559780645941132601584026964732002814421328931645273857322194566123042109799648288341659241
44195908993470810395454139914749549173182100482654375041866001007895545034035110480878595761